Mandog - Taklech, Shimla
Mandog is a village situated in the Taklech tehsil of Shimla district, Himachal Pradesh. It is located approximately 135 km from Shimla. Narain serves as the Gram Panchayat for Mandog village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Mandog is 023654. The village covers a total geographical area of 163.57 hectares and falls under the 172022 pincode. Rampur is the nearest town.
Mandog village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Rampur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Mandi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Mandog
As per Census 2011, Mandog village has a total population of 467 people, consisting of 234 males and 233 females. The village has 100 households and a sex ratio of 995 females per 1,000 males. There are 42 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 334 literate and 133 illiterate residents. Additionally, 101 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 3 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Mandog are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 467 | 234 | 233 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 42 | 23 | 19 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 101 | 54 | 47 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 3 | 1 | 2 |
| Literate Population | 334 | 186 | 148 |
| Illiterate Population | 133 | 48 | 85 |

Transport and Connectivity of Mandog
Public transport facilities are available within 2-5 km of the Mandog.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Private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. the road distance from Shimla to Mandog is about 135 km, with the usual travel time around ~3.9 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
Banking and Postal Services in Mandog
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Mandog village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within >10 km |
| ATM | No | Available within >10 km |
| Post Office | No | Available within 5-10 km |
Health Facilities in Mandog
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Mandog village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| No | Available within >10 km |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
